Wonderful exercise that anyone can do in a small space, even if you only have a few minutes to paint! That is such a good tip about using the brush to lift excess water- it's so important to preserve the paper surface, and a lot of blotting techniques tend to lift too much sizing or abrade the paper. It's remarkable how much a skilled painter can do with a single, high quality brush!
